Madison McCord Interiors - August Business of the Month! Madison McCord Interiors has been designing and selling custom furniture for over 27 years. Originally founded in Northern California, the business moved to Utah in 2012, starting in a small Millcreek showroom before expanding in 2014 to a 22,000-square-foot space. They specialize in furniture sales and U.S.-manufactured custom upholstery and are known for having the largest selection of accent pillows in Utah. Madison McCord Interiors is proud to carry exclusive items like their Picasso pillows—imported from the museum in Paris—and has been featured in Salt Lake Magazine’s Women in Business for 12 consecutive years. Beyond business, the owner supports Utah Animal Advocacy and regularly fosters dogs in the showroom, often leading to adoptions. As a local business, they champion the importance of shopping local and remain committed to providing excellent service despite growing challenges from tariffs and online competition.
